ICP-AES Determination of Total Amount of Sulfur in Glass

Abstract
A rapid and accurate method of ICP-AES determination of total amount of sulfur in glass was reported.Conditions of determination,including methods of sample dissolution,choice of analytical spectral lines,spectral interferences of co-existing elements and working parameters of the instrument were studied thoroughly.The spectral line (S 181.972 nm) in the ultraviolet ragion was selected for the determination to prevent the interference of large amounts of calcium in the matrix.Test for precision of the method was made with 5 standard or known samples,giving values of RSD′s (n=5) less than 1.5%.Blank tests were done for 11 times and the detection limit (3S) was calculated,giving the value of 0.01 mg·L-1.Accuracy of the method was checked by the analysis of some CRM′s (e.g.,NBS 89 and GBW 03117),the results obtained were in consistency with the certified values.
